Transaction 13af2b9c6a44aa5f725c47e44152eae88de76125974cb12d9dfc51d951f7e821

1 Input
1 Outputs
  • 13af2b9c6a44aa5f725c47e44152eae88de76125974cb12d9dfc51d951f7e821:0
  • value  680456
    address  36bx1Z8Kbja64YtfwdrfWuftrKegJq7E1f